Apple Music API Python: Build Powerful Music Apps Today

Apple Music API Python lets you integrate playlists and tracks into your app, streamlining development with powerful music data tools.
Apple Music API Python: Build Powerful Music Apps Today
Denis Calakovic

Music streaming has become a dominant force in how people discover, listen to, and share music. With millions of artists, tracks, and playlists available at your fingertips, managing such vast amounts of data can seem overwhelming. That's where music streaming APIs come in, making it easy to access and integrate this data into your apps, platforms, or internal tools. This article will explore some use cases of music streaming APIs and specifically focus on how they can be integrated to enhance your projects.

 

📌 Viberate Analytics: Professional music analytics suite at an unbeatable price: $19.90/mo. Charts, talent discovery tools, plus Spotify, TikTok, and other channel-specific analytics of every artist out there.

What is a Music Streaming API?

A music streaming API is a set of tools that allows developers to interact with music platforms programmatically. With the help of these APIs, you can access and retrieve information about artists, tracks, playlists, labels, and much more. These APIs provide an efficient way to pull in dynamic data from the music industry without manually updating content on your app or website.

APIs like Viberate’s Music Analytics API are powerful because they offer comprehensive data that’s refreshed daily. For instance, Viberate tracks over 11 million artists, 100 million songs, 19 million playlists, and a wide range of festivals, labels, and venues. This wealth of data can be used for various applications, from artist discovery to improving user engagement on music platforms.

Use Cases for Music APIs

Music streaming APIs are essential for a wide range of stakeholders within the music industry. Here are a few examples of how different entities can leverage these tools:

Talent Agencies

Talent agencies can use music streaming APIs to automatically feed signature content, gig dates, and other relevant information into their artists' profiles. Instead of manually updating profiles, the data can be refreshed daily, saving time and reducing human error.

Collecting Societies, Publishers, and Distributors

For collecting societies, publishers, and distributors, music APIs offer an opportunity to enhance internal reporting tools. By feeding data into artists' profiles and providing clients with detailed analytics, these entities can rank and present artists and tracks based on popularity and other metrics. This can improve their ability to monitor music trends and make informed decisions.

Labels

Music labels often need to discover emerging talent and keep up with industry trends. With APIs like Viberate’s, they can apply advanced A&R (Artist & Repertoire) filters to search for new artists and source verified data directly into their internal tools.

App Developers

Developers creating music-related applications can integrate music streaming APIs into their platforms to pull in real-time data. Whether you're building an app that showcases festival lineups or one that curates playlists based on trends, APIs can help you automatically update content without manual intervention. One of the most popular APIs developers use is the Apple Music API, which we'll explore in the next section.

Apple Music API: Unlocking the Potential with Python

Among the available music APIs, Apple Music’s API stands out for its ability to provide access to millions of songs and playlists. This API allows developers to search for songs, retrieve playlists, and even create personalized music experiences for users. The is particularly powerful because Python is a versatile programming language that can handle API integration seamlessly.

If you're working with large sets of music data, integrating the Apple Music API can offer a streamlined way to manage and analyze this data. For example, you could build an app that recommends new songs based on a user’s listening history or generate reports on playlist popularity. Viberate’s Music Analytics service also offers Apple Music API, enabling users to integrate playlist data into their platforms easily.

By combining the power of Apple Music’s API with Python, you can:

  • Access millions of tracks and playlists programmatically.
  • Retrieve playlist data and use it to create personalized user experiences.
  • Analyze trends and deliver meaningful music recommendations to users.

Why Choose Viberate's Music API?

While Apple Music API offers incredible functionality, Viberate's Music API takes it a step further by covering the entire music ecosystem. It not only pulls data from platforms like Apple Music, Spotify, and YouTube Music, but it also integrates data from social media platforms such as TikTok. This allows developers to gather comprehensive insights into an artist’s performance across multiple channels. Here’s why Viberate’s API stands out:

1. Unique Artist IDs

Viberate offers the highest data integrity on the market, with unique artist IDs that ensure no duplicate entries. This means that every artist has one profile, and you won’t encounter issues with duplicated data, which can skew analysis.

Viberate Analytics: Professional music analytics suite at an unbeatable price: $19.90/mo. Charts, talent discovery tools, plus Spotify, TikTok, and other channel-specific analytics of every artist out there.

2. Comprehensive Music Ecosystem

Viberate maps, analyzes, and ranks millions of artists, tracks, playlists, venues, labels, festivals, and events, providing users with a one-stop-shop for music and social media performance data. Whether you need data for A&R purposes, event management, or marketing, Viberate has you covered.

3. Affordable and Flexible Pricing

Viberate’s API packages are designed to be accessible to businesses of all sizes, from early-stage startups to international music giants. This flexibility ensures that you can scale your use of the API according to your budget and needs.

4. Daily-Refreshed Data

One of the most significant advantages of using Viberate’s Music API is that it provides daily-refreshed data on millions of artists, songs, and playlists. This ensures that your applications or platforms stay up-to-date with the latest music trends and industry movements.

Practical Applications of the Viberate Music API

Incorporating a robust API like Viberate’s into your platform or app can yield numerous benefits. Here are some practical applications:

  • A&R and Talent Discovery: Use advanced filters to identify emerging talent and monitor their performance over time.
  • Music Platforms: Provide users with real-time playlist updates, track popularity metrics, and artist rankings.
  • Event Management: Use festival data to integrate lineups into your event-planning tools.
  • Social Media Analytics: Track the social media engagement of artists and how it correlates with their streaming performance.

By leveraging the API, developers and music professionals can build applications that provide value to their users while streamlining the management of music data.

Viberate Analytics: Professional music analytics suite at an unbeatable price: $19.90/mo. Charts, talent discovery tools, plus Spotify, TikTok, and other channel-specific analytics of every artist out there.

Conclusion

Music streaming APIs like Viberate’s offer a wealth of opportunities for businesses and developers looking to leverage music data. Whether you’re a talent agency, record label, app developer, or music distributor, using an API to automate data retrieval and management can save time and improve efficiency. When combined with tools like Apple Music API with Python, you can create personalized music experiences, analyze trends, and provide valuable insights to your users. Explore how Viberate’s Music Analytics service can integrate with your platform and elevate your music data strategy to the next level.

Viberate Analytics

Premium music analytics, unbeatable price: $19.90/month

11M+ artists, 100M+ songs, 19M+ playlists, 6K+ festivals and 100K+ labels on one platform, built for industry professionals.

Viberate for Artists

All the tools an independent musician needs: $2.99/month

Music distribution, advancing, a free website, playlist & festival pitching, plus analytics to back up your work.

Denis Calakovic

Denis Calakovic

Head of Database at Viberate
Avid concert-goer, a sucker for creative wordsmithery, and 100 % biodegradable. Google "melomaniac".